Understanding Ciprofloxacin: A Potent Antibiotic

Ciprofloxacin is a powerful antibiotic that belongs to the fluoroquinolone class of medications. It’s widely prescribed to combat various bacterial infections by interfering with the DNA replication process in bacteria, ultimately killing them or stopping their growth. This mechanism makes ciprofloxacin effective against many types of bacteria, including those responsible for urinary tract infections, respiratory tract infections, and gastrointestinal infections.

This antibiotic is available in multiple forms—oral tablets, intravenous injections, and eye or ear drops—allowing doctors to tailor treatment based on the infection site and severity. Ciprofloxacin is not effective against viral infections like the common cold or flu; it specifically targets bacterial pathogens.

The Spectrum of Bacterial Infections Treated by Ciprofloxacin

Ciprofloxacin’s broad-spectrum activity means it tackles a diverse array of bacterial invaders. Here are some common infections where ciprofloxacin plays a critical role:

Urinary Tract Infections (UTIs)

One of the most frequent reasons for prescribing ciprofloxacin is a urinary tract infection. These infections occur when bacteria enter the urinary system, causing symptoms such as pain during urination, frequent urge to urinate, and lower abdominal pain. Ciprofloxacin targets the common culprits like Escherichia coli (E. coli), which causes most UTIs.

Respiratory Tract Infections

Ciprofloxacin treats certain respiratory infections caused by bacteria such as Haemophilus influenzae and Streptococcus pneumoniae. It’s particularly useful for bronchitis and pneumonia when caused by susceptible strains. However, it’s generally reserved for cases where other antibiotics are ineffective or not tolerated.

Gastrointestinal Infections

Bacterial gastroenteritis caused by pathogens like Salmonella, Shigella, and Campylobacter can be treated with ciprofloxacin. It helps reduce symptoms such as diarrhea, fever, and abdominal cramps by eliminating the infectious bacteria in the gut.

Skin and Soft Tissue Infections

Infections involving skin wounds or soft tissues sometimes require ciprofloxacin if resistant bacteria are involved or if other antibiotics fail. Conditions like cellulitis or infected ulcers may benefit from this treatment under medical supervision.

Bone and Joint Infections

Though less common, ciprofloxacin can be part of therapy for osteomyelitis (bone infection) or septic arthritis when caused by specific sensitive bacteria.

Ciprofloxacin’s Mode of Action: How It Fights Bacteria

Ciprofloxacin works by targeting two crucial bacterial enzymes: DNA gyrase and topoisomerase IV. These enzymes play vital roles in DNA replication and cell division in bacteria. By inhibiting these enzymes, ciprofloxacin disrupts DNA synthesis, preventing bacteria from reproducing and repairing themselves.

This mechanism differs from many other antibiotics that attack cell walls or protein synthesis directly. Because ciprofloxacin attacks DNA processes unique to bacteria, it tends to have selective toxicity—meaning it harms bacteria but spares human cells.

The result? The bacterial population declines quickly, reducing infection symptoms and helping your immune system clear up the rest.

Ciprofloxacin Dosage Forms & Administration Routes

Doctors choose how you receive ciprofloxacin based on your infection type and severity:

Dosage Form Description Common Uses
Oral Tablets/Capsules Easily swallowed pills taken by mouth. Mild to moderate UTIs, respiratory infections.
Intravenous (IV) Injection Ciprofloxacin delivered directly into the bloodstream. Severe infections requiring hospitalization.
Ear/Eye Drops Drops applied locally to treat infections. Bacterial conjunctivitis; outer ear infections.

Oral dosing is convenient for outpatient treatment while IV administration is reserved for serious cases needing rapid drug levels in blood. Topical drops allow targeted therapy without systemic effects.

The Importance of Following Prescribed Dosage & Duration

Taking ciprofloxacin exactly as prescribed is crucial. Skipping doses or stopping early can lead to incomplete eradication of bacteria. This encourages antibiotic resistance—a serious global health problem where bacteria evolve to survive even powerful drugs like ciprofloxacin.

Typically, courses last from 5 to 14 days depending on infection type and severity. Your healthcare provider determines the right dose based on factors like age, kidney function, and infection site.

Never double-dose if you miss one; instead take the next dose at its scheduled time unless instructed otherwise. Finishing your full course helps ensure that all harmful bacteria are wiped out.

Ciprofloxacin Side Effects: What You Should Know

Like any medication, ciprofloxacin comes with possible side effects ranging from mild to severe:

    • Mild Effects:
      Nausea, diarrhea, headache, dizziness are common but often temporary.
    • Tendon Problems:
      Rarely, ciprofloxacin can cause tendon inflammation or rupture—especially in older adults or those on steroids.
    • Nervous System:
      Some users experience confusion, hallucinations, or seizures though these are uncommon.
    • Sensitivity to Sunlight:
      Ciprofloxacin can make skin more sensitive; avoid excessive sun exposure.
    • Liver Issues:
      In rare cases liver enzyme elevations occur; watch for yellowing skin or dark urine.

If you notice any severe symptoms like difficulty breathing or swelling face/throat—seek emergency care immediately as these may indicate an allergic reaction.

Avoiding Drug Interactions With Ciprofloxacin

Ciprofloxacin interacts with several medications which may affect how well it works or increase side effects:

    • Dairy Products & Antacids:
      Calcium-containing products can bind ciprofloxacin in your stomach reducing absorption; avoid taking them together within a few hours.
    • Theophylline:
      Using both can raise risk of side effects like nervousness or seizures.
    • Blood Thinners (Warfarin):
      Ciprofloxacin may increase bleeding risk; close monitoring required.
    • Steroids:
      Combination increases risk of tendon damage.

Always tell your doctor about all medications and supplements you take before starting ciprofloxacin.

The Growing Concern: Antibiotic Resistance & Ciprofloxacin Use

Antibiotic resistance happens when bacteria change so drugs no longer kill them effectively. Overuse or misuse of antibiotics accelerates this process worldwide—including with ciprofloxacin.

Doctors now emphasize using ciprofloxacin only when necessary after confirming susceptibility through lab tests whenever possible. This approach helps preserve its effectiveness for serious infections that truly need it.

Patients should never self-prescribe antibiotics nor share leftover pills with others since improper usage promotes resistance development.

Ciprofloxacin vs Other Antibiotics: When Is It Preferred?

Choosing an antibiotic depends on several factors including bacterial type involved, infection location, patient allergies, drug side effect profile, and local resistance patterns.

Ciprofloxacin stands out because:

    • Its broad spectrum covers many Gram-negative bacteria effectively.
    • The oral form has excellent bioavailability making outpatient treatment easy.
    • The drug penetrates tissues well including bones and respiratory tract fluids.

However,

    • Ciprofloxacin isn’t ideal against many Gram-positive organisms compared to alternatives like amoxicillin or cephalexin.
    • Tendon risks make it less preferred in children and elderly unless no better option exists.
    • Bacterial resistance rates vary regionally affecting success rates.

Doctors weigh these pros and cons carefully before prescribing this antibiotic over others.

The Role Of Ciprofloxacin In Treating Serious Infections

For life-threatening conditions such as complicated intra-abdominal infections or sepsis caused by susceptible organisms, ciprofloxacin often forms part of combination therapy alongside other antibiotics. Its ability to rapidly reduce bacterial load helps improve outcomes especially when administered intravenously under hospital care.

In cases involving multidrug-resistant organisms sensitive only to fluoroquinolones like ciprofloxacin—this drug becomes essential despite risks associated with its use.

Caring For Yourself While Taking Ciprofloxacin

To get the best results from your treatment:

    • Avoid sun exposure:Your skin may burn easier during treatment so wear protective clothing or sunscreen outdoors.
    • No strenuous exercise:Tendon injury risk means heavy physical activity should be limited until after finishing medication.
    • Diet considerations:Avoid dairy products close to dosing times but maintain balanced nutrition overall for healing support.
    • Mental alertness:If dizziness occurs avoid driving or operating machinery until effects subside.
    • No alcohol:This may worsen side effects like stomach upset or dizziness during therapy.

Following these tips helps minimize complications while maximizing antibiotic effectiveness during your course of treatment.
